WebJun 4, 2024 · When people think of Irish literature, James Joyce is frequently the first name that comes to mind. Thanks to his distinct modernist style, which revolutionized fiction writing in the early twentieth century, he is unquestionably the most important Irish writer, as well as one of the most important writers in the world.
